Transaction 39a6bce1ec0bb71602d698af91271e2d2d1c495bd1733d25f5da99cd79626ee5
1 Input
1 Output
-
39a6bce1ec0bb71602d698af91271e2d2d1c495bd1733d25f5da99cd79626ee5:0
- value
- 2050514
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e37bbe6da86430673a87aac42feea6c2efc5eff0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MjpdRLojfSYcTHD5Jk6iuAgS1PKc6zMpQ